Fink

Anleitung zur Aktualisierung unter Mac OS X 10.6

Wichtige Anmerkungen:

Haben sie Xquartz 2.4 unter 10.5 installiert, wird es wahrscheinlich einfacher sein, einen clean install aus den Quellen durchzuführen.


Führen sie folgende Sequenz aus, um ihre Installation von Fink von 10.5/32 bit auf 10.6/32 bit zu aktualisieren (Es gibt keinen direkten Weg von früheren Betriebsystemversionen):

  1. Vor der Installation von OS X 10.6, führen sie
    fink selfupdate
    aus, wobei rsync oder cvs eingeschaltet ist, d. h.
    fink selfupdate-rsync
    oder
    fink selfupdate-cvs
    . Dies aktualisiert fink auf eine laufende Version.
    Überprüfen sie die Version ihres Paketmanagers mittels
    fink -V
    . Die Version muss vor der Aktualisierung mindestens 0.29.9 sein.
    Machen sie auf keinen Fall weiter, wenn ihre Version niedriger ist als 0.29.9! Sie müssen diesen Anweisungen folgen, um Fink zu aktualisieren.
  2. Editieren sie die Datei /sw/etc/fink.conf und fügen sie folgende Zeile ein: NoAutoIndex: true. (Sie werden sudo oder eine ähnliche Methode brauchen, um die Rechte zu erhalten, die für das Editieren der Datei notwendig sind.)
  3. Installieren sie OS X 10.6 und Xcode 3.2 (oder eine spätere Version).
  4. Führen sie das Kommando
    fink reinstall fink
    aus, damit fink erfährt, dass es jetzt auf 10.6 läuft. (Bekommen sie eine Meldung über eine korrupte Paket-Datenbank, führen sie
    fink index -f
    aus und versuchen sie diesen Schritt noch einmal.)
  5. Führen sie das Kommando
    fink update fink
    aus, damit sie das neueste fink für 10.6 erhalten.
  6. Führen sie das Kommando
    fink install perl588-core
    aus, wenn sie Fink-Pakete haben, die von Perl abhängen. Die Perl-Version des Systems wurde beim Upgrade verändert.
  7. Entfernen sie die Zeile NoAutoIndex: true aus der Datei fink.conf.

Nach dem Upgrade wollen sie vermutlich das Kommando

fink
configure
ausführen, um ein wenig aufzuräumen.